-- 作者:ibehujun
-- 发布时间:2014/4/23 21:43:00
--
在甜兄的代码上精简了一下,正是需要的效果。
For Each page As WinForm.TopicPage In e.Sender.Pages For Each link As Object In page.Links link.text = link.Text.Replace("★", "") Next Next e.Link.Text += "★"
好多新知识点:
1. e.Sender (在控件的事件代码中,如果要引用控件本身,也应该使用e参数:e.Sender,如果采用控件名称来引用,那么一旦需要修改控件名称,就必须同步修改代码)
2. .Replace(查找给定的子字符串,并用另一个子字符替换掉找到的子字符串。Replace(OldValue, NewValue))
3. +=,这个用法怎么也搜不到?请问怎么理解啊
|